Rapala Pro Guide™ Lock 'n Weigh™/Lock 'N Grip™

Quickly and safely land and weigh even the largest species with only one hand. Once you have the fish boat-side, simply slide the Lock ’n Weigh over the bottom jaw. The patent-pending cam-lock system grabs onto the fish so you can lift it and check its weight on the highly accurate (+/- 3% accuracy) built-in scale. The new Magnum has redesigned extra-wide jaws to accommodate larger saltwater species. Crafted of high-grade stainless steel for lasting performance in harsh saltwater environments, all Lock ’n Weigh models also have padded no-slip handles for a sure grip and a wrist lanyard to keep them from going overboard. Dual-release triggers reliably retract the locking mechanism for hassle-free releases. The Lock ’n Grip is available with or without a digital scale. It features a rubberized lever-style handle for comfortable hand positioning throughout the lift and release. The Lock ’n Grip uses the same patent-pending cam-lock system and high-grade stainless steel used for the Lock ’n Weigh units.
Available:
  • Lock ’n Grip with digital scale
  • Lock ’n Grip (no scale)
